Constants ¶
const ( SIGNATURE uint64 = 0xE11AB1A1E011CFD0 SMALLER_BIG_BLOCK_SIZE = 0x0200 LARGER_BIG_BLOCK_SIZE = 0x1000 SMALL_BLOCK_SIZE = 0x0040 PROPERTY_SIZE = 0x0080 //How big single property is /** * The minimum size of a document before it's stored using * Big Blocks (normal streams). Smaller documents go in the * Mini Stream (SBAT / Small Blocks) */ BIG_BLOCK_MINIMUM_DOCUMENT_SIZE = 0x1000 /** The highest sector number you're allowed, 0xFFFFFFFA */ LARGEST_REGULAR_SECTOR_NUMBER = -5 /** Indicates the sector holds a DIFAT block (0xFFFFFFFC) */ DIFAT_SECTOR_BLOCK = -4 /** Indicates the sector holds a FAT block (0xFFFFFFFD) */ FAT_SECTOR_BLOCK = -3 /** Indicates the sector is the end of a chain (0xFFFFFFFE) */ END_OF_CHAIN = -2 /** Indicates the sector is not used (0xFFFFFFFF) */ UNUSED_BLOCK = -1 )
const ( BYTE_SIZE = 1 SHORT_SIZE = 2 INT_SIZE = 4 LONG_SIZE = 8 DOUBLE_SIZE = 8 )
const ( PROPERTY_TYPE_OFFSET int = 0x42 DIRECTORY_TYPE = 1 DOCUMENT_TYPE = 2 ROOT_TYPE = 5 )
const ( BLOCK_SHIFT = 6 BLOCK_MASK = _block_size - 1 MAX_BLOCK_COUNT = 65535 )
